# 防火墙规则库管理复杂且难以进行自动优化
## 引言
随着网络攻击手段的不断升级,防火墙作为网络安全的第一道防线,其重要性不言而喻。然而,防火墙规则库的管理却面临着复杂且难以自动优化的困境。本文将深入分析这一问题,并探讨如何利用AI技术来提升防火墙规则库的管理效率和优化能力。
## 一、防火墙规则库管理的复杂性
### 1.1 规则数量庞大
现代企业网络环境复杂,防火墙需要处理大量的网络流量,导致规则库中的规则数量迅速增加。一条条规则的增加不仅增加了管理难度,还可能导致规则冲突和性能下降。
### 1.2 规则复杂性高
防火墙规则通常涉及多种参数,如源地址、目标地址、端口号、协议类型等。复杂的规则设置使得管理员在配置和维护时容易出错。
### 1.3 规则更新频繁
随着业务需求的不断变化,防火墙规则需要频繁更新。每次更新都可能引发新的冲突或漏洞,增加了管理的复杂性。
### 1.4 缺乏统一管理工具
目前市场上缺乏统一且高效的防火墙规则管理工具,导致管理员需要手动操作多个防火墙设备,工作效率低下。
## 二、防火墙规则库自动优化的难点
### 2.1 规则冲突检测
防火墙规则之间的冲突是自动优化的主要障碍之一。检测和解决规则冲突需要复杂的逻辑推理和大量的计算资源。
### 2.2 性能优化
优化防火墙规则不仅要考虑安全性,还要兼顾网络性能。如何在保证安全的前提下提升网络性能是一个难题。
### 2.3 动态环境适应
网络环境是动态变化的,防火墙规则需要实时调整以适应新的威胁和业务需求。自动优化系统需要具备高度的自适应能力。
### 2.4 数据隐私保护
在自动优化过程中,如何保护敏感数据不被泄露,确保数据隐私安全,是一个必须解决的问题。
## 三、AI技术在防火墙规则库管理中的应用
### 3.1 规则冲突检测与解决
#### 3.1.1 机器学习算法
利用机器学习算法,可以对防火墙规则进行建模,自动检测潜在的规则冲突。通过训练模型,系统能够识别出冲突规则,并提出优化建议。
#### 3.1.2 专家系统
结合专家系统,可以将领域专家的知识和经验编码成规则,辅助机器学习算法进行冲突检测和解决。专家系统可以在复杂场景下提供更准确的判断。
### 3.2 性能优化
#### 3.2.1 强化学习
通过强化学习算法,可以在模拟环境中不断尝试不同的规则组合,找到最优的规则配置,以提升网络性能。强化学习能够根据反馈不断调整策略,逐步逼近最优解。
#### 3.2.2 遗传算法
遗传算法通过模拟自然选择和遗传过程,能够在大量规则组合中筛选出性能最优的配置。这种方法适用于大规模复杂网络的性能优化。
### 3.3 动态环境适应
#### 3.3.1 自适应神经网络
自适应神经网络能够根据实时数据动态调整规则库,以适应不断变化的网络环境。通过持续学习和调整,神经网络可以保持规则库的最佳状态。
#### 3.3.2 事件驱动机制
结合事件驱动机制,AI系统可以实时监控网络事件,并根据事件类型和严重程度自动调整防火墙规则,确保网络安全的实时性。
### 3.4 数据隐私保护
#### 3.4.1 差分隐私技术
在数据处理过程中,采用差分隐私技术,可以在保护数据隐私的前提下,进行规则库的优化和分析。差分隐私通过添加噪声,确保单个数据无法被识别。
#### 3.4.2 同态加密
利用同态加密技术,可以在不解密数据的情况下进行规则库的优化操作,确保敏感数据的安全性。
## 四、解决方案与实践案例
### 4.1 统一管理平台
#### 4.1.1 平台架构
构建一个统一的防火墙规则管理平台,集成AI技术,实现对多个防火墙设备的集中管理和自动优化。平台架构包括数据采集层、数据处理层、决策层和执行层。
#### 4.1.2 功能模块
- **数据采集模块**:实时收集防火墙日志和网络流量数据。
- **数据处理模块**:对数据进行预处理和特征提取。
- **决策模块**:利用AI算法进行规则冲突检测、性能优化和动态调整。
- **执行模块**:将优化后的规则自动应用到防火墙设备。
### 4.2 实践案例
#### 4.2.1 某大型企业防火墙优化项目
某大型企业在部署防火墙时,面临规则库管理复杂、性能低下的问题。通过引入AI技术,构建了统一的防火墙规则管理平台,实现了以下效果:
- **规则冲突检测**:利用机器学习算法,成功检测并解决了多条冲突规则。
- **性能优化**:通过强化学习,优化了规则配置,网络性能提升了30%。
- **动态适应**:自适应神经网络确保了规则库能够实时适应网络环境变化。
- **数据隐私保护**:采用差分隐私技术,确保了数据处理的隐私安全。
#### 4.2.2 金融行业防火墙管理优化
某金融企业在防火墙管理中,面临规则更新频繁、管理效率低的问题。通过引入AI技术,实现了以下优化:
- **自动化更新**:AI系统根据业务需求自动更新规则,减少了人工干预。
- **冲突检测**:专家系统辅助机器学习,有效检测和解决了规则冲突。
- **性能监控**:实时监控网络性能,动态调整规则,确保高可用性。
## 五、未来展望
### 5.1 技术发展趋势
随着AI技术的不断进步,防火墙规则库管理将更加智能化和自动化。未来,以下技术将成为发展趋势:
- **深度学习**:利用深度学习算法,进一步提升规则冲突检测和性能优化的准确性。
- **联邦学习**:通过联邦学习,实现多企业间的协同优化,提升整体网络安全水平。
- **量子计算**:量子计算的应用将大幅提升规则库管理的计算能力,解决复杂优化问题。
### 5.2 行业应用前景
AI技术在防火墙规则库管理中的应用前景广阔,尤其在以下行业:
- **金融行业**:保障金融交易的安全性和高效性。
- **医疗行业**:保护患者隐私数据,确保医疗网络的安全。
- **制造业**:提升工业控制系统的网络安全防护能力。
## 结语
防火墙规则库管理复杂且难以进行自动优化,是当前网络安全领域的一大挑战。通过引入AI技术,可以有效解决规则冲突、性能优化、动态适应和数据隐私保护等问题。未来,随着技术的不断进步,AI将在防火墙规则库管理中发挥更大的作用,为网络安全提供更坚实的保障。